Course Overview

Pursue your ambitions in law with the LLB (Hons) Law (LLB) at University of Stirling. Based in Stirling, Scotland, this programme combines theoretical knowledge with practical application, with a 4-year full-time structure. If you’re planning a career in the legal profession, our LLB degree provides a well-rounded qualification that can be your first step towards becoming a Scots lawyer or entering other prestigious sectors. The University of Stirling LLB offers in-depth knowledge and understanding of legal principles, theories, institutions and rules – as well as the wider social and political context in which law operates. You’ll benefit from the knowledge of our expert teaching staff, whose own legal research is widely published and feeds back into the LLB programme.
